  Ratings distributionRatings distribution Average Rating = (n ÷ (n + m)) × av + (m ÷ (n + m)) × AV
where:
av = trimmed mean average rating an item has currently received.
n = number of ratings an item has currently received.
m = minimum number of ratings required for an item to appear in a 'top-rated' chart (currently 10).
AV = the site mean average rating.

Rating metrics: Outliers can be removed when calculating a mean average to dampen the effects of ratings outside the normal distribution. This figure is provided as the trimmed mean. A high standard deviation can be legitimate, but can sometimes indicate 'gaming' is occurring. Consider a simplified example* of an item receiving ratings of 100, 50, & 0. The mean average rating would be 50. However, ratings of 55, 50 & 45 could also result in the same average. The second average might be more trusted because there is more consensus around a particular rating (a lower deviation).
(*In practice, some albums can have several thousand ratings)

This album has a Bayesian average rating of 72.1/100, a mean average of 70.2/100, and a trimmed mean (excluding outliers) of 72.0/100. The standard deviation for this album is 15.4.

85/100 (Earworm melodies and beautiful pop hooks mixed with gnarly, dirty, beautiful guitar breakdowns meets a dancy and playful attitude throughout. This album is a blast and I recommend it to people who like Noise Pop or kinda exuberant dance punkish stuff. Hard to describe but great nonetheless.)

Personally I couldn't resist the charms of this album. The vocals are underwhelming and maybe the weakest aspect of the music, but even they have their moments. The guitars are consistently gnarly, nasty, beautiful yet ugly. The drums parts and tempo changes are refreshing and brilliantly wacky and random. The songs are a nice mix of pop and noise rock and dance punk, and when the songs get heavy they get REALLY in your face heavy. When the songs are just bubblegum pop they are quite sweet and fragile. Sometimes these 2 elements slam together in the same song, such as on "Like A Lady". These songs that feature whiplash changes are my personal favorite of the album. But most of these songs find a pocket, a melody and a riff and just extrapolate nicely from that starting point. Makes for a fast 33 minute rush of excellent rock music.

I am not familiar with much stuff on the Noisey end of pop and punk, so this may be a tried and true sound that is not amazingly original. I wouldn't know. I do know that it had me smiling and rocking for its entirety, then it had me pushing play again and again for further listens. Its both accessible and gnarly, and its one of my fave albums in this young year.
